Where is the default gateway for the relocated devices when relocating on-premise devices to Azure?
On-premise PCs are to be relocated using Cisco's LISP.
The default gateway of the PC to be moved is currently facing the L3SW address (192.168.10.254).
When moving the target PC to Azure, change the address of the default gateway to the address of the Router (192.168.10.254).
(192.168.10.200)?
<Configuration diagram
|PC|---------|L3SW|-----------|Router|------WAN------|Azure Router|---------|PC"|
IP address
PC:192.168.10.1/24 GW:192.168.10.254
L3SW(SVI):192.168.10.254/24
Router:192.168.10.200/24
<Role
・Router is on-premises.
・Azure Router is in the cloud.
・Router plays the role of xTR, MR/MS and Proxy xTR.
・Azure Router is in the role of XTR.
・Azure Router is an IPv4 locator and uses PETR ipv4 use-petr "Router IP".
・L3SW has a SVI for the VLAN of the segment extending to Azure.
・The SVI of the VLAN of the segment to be extended to Azure exists in the L3SW.
・The SVI of the VLAN of the segment to be extended to Azure exists in the L3SW.
・Connect L3SW and Router by trunk.

I would use the on-prem router as a default gateway for both the on-prem and Azure devices during the migration. It is also possible to have an anycast gateway, but I don't see any benefit of that in this scenario. Once the migration is finished you can configure your Azure located router as the default gateway.
